Abstract

Abstract. The growing importance of physical preparation in the training plans of handball coaches must be the basis for consolidation and improvement during the specific training of junior handball players. The higher the motor indicators, the higher the difference between the technical and tactical skills of junior handball players in terms of achieving maximum efficiency. The research took place over an eight-month period. The research participants were 32 U17 junior handball players aged 15 and 16 years. They were divided into two groups as follows: the experimental group, consisting of 15 handball players from the Bucharest Municipal Sports Club, and the control group, consisting of 17 handball players from the Bucharest School Sports Club No. 2. The methods used for the experimental group included set training circuits performed in the corresponding part of basic training. Each training circuit was introduced systematically and quantifiably for 15 minutes, three times a week on successive days and according to the training period covered by the U17 male handball team. The training of the control group was based on traditional methods provided in the annual training plan. Throughout this period, the specific physical training parameters of the experimental group were influenced by the chosen training methods: for speed endurance in different directions and at different angles with forward, backward and lateral movements; for the ability to rotate in different directions and at different angles with an emphasis on execution speed, acceleration speed, speed endurance, agility and body control.
